What are the minimum hardware requirements for ESX 4.0?
|
64-bit x86 CPUs and 2GB of RAM

What are the required partitions for ESX hosts?
|
/boot (ext3), / (ext3), swap, vmkcore, VMFS3
|
|
What are the optional partitions for ESX hosts?
|
/home, /tmp, /var/log, /usr,

What are the minimum hardware requirements for ESX 4.0 vCenter?
|
two CPUs 2.0GHz+ Intel or AMD, 3GB of RAM, 2GB drive storage, 1GB NIC, [if DB is local] space needed for MSSQL Express 2005 (2GB minimum)
|
|
Where do you configure NTP for the ESX host?
|
GUI: Select an ESX server, Configuration tab, and click on Time Configuration.
CLI: edit /etc/ntp.conf and add the servers. server 0.nl.pool.ntp.org |

What are the steps in the ESX backup procedure?
|
1. Backup the files in /etc/passwd, /etc/groups, /etc/shadow, and /etc/gshadow (some of these directories may not be present in all installs).
2. Backup custom scripts 3. Backup .vmx files 4. Backup local images (templates, exported virtual machines, and .iso files) |
|
What are the steps in the ESXi backup procedure?
|
1. Install vSphere CLI
2. In the CLI run vicfg-cfgbackup with the -s flag to save host configuration to a specified backup filename. vicfg-cfgbackup --server <ESXi-host-ip> --portnumber <port_number> --protocol <protocol_type> --username username --password <password> -s <backup-filename> |

What is the recommended deployment size when using the host update utility?
|
Smaller deployments of 10 hosts or less without a vCetner Server or vCenter Update Manager. This utility provides a wizard that will walk you through the upgrade process.
